Finally, I found a 120g for a used price $200.
She’s the ugliest most beautiful thing I have ever laid eyes on. I’m going to strip the two overflows, add a ghost overflow and oh so much more to get this one wet again. I decided to put my money towards reputable equipment, instead of the glass box. (Good timing considering frameless tanks are losing fashion, dang you Red Sea.)
My previous tank was a cadlight 60g and just a frameless beauty. That tank grew coral but limped by with basic equipment. (Lighting,Powerheads, manually dosing) Time to flourish and establish a low maintenance 120g for this reefer.
